Acronis Disk Director Application Error with WinPE (built by Acronis media builder)
I currently use Acronis Disk Director 11 Home (build 11.0.216) for my laptop's disk management. I try to build a bootable ISO file with WinPE by using the "Acronis Media Builder" in Acronis Disk Director 11 Home.
After the ISO image is created, I burnt it into a disc and reboot my laptop with the disc. Then I get "ManagementConsole.exe Application Error" as attachment.
The configuration of my laptop (Dell latitude 6420) is: Intel Core i5-2520M; 8GB RAM; 320GB Hard Disk; OS: Windows7 Pro 64-bit.
The process I make the Bootable ISO file is as following:
Next->Bootable Media Type: Windows PE; Create Windows PE 2.x or 3.0 automatically->Next (No driver added)->ISO image->Next->Process
I do some observation and investigation by myself:
1. Use this disc to boot my old laptop (ASUS F3JC; 2GB RAM; 80GB Hard Disk, WindowsXP Pro SP1), the Acronis Disk Director start successfully without error.
2. As the command line windows appeared, I found the file it cope for winpe is all from x86 folder.
x86 architecture support 32 bits, 32-bit system only limited to 4GB memory. My guess this problem is caused by more than 4GB RAM in WinPE, then it make sense that the disc can work on my old laptop which has RAM less than 4GB.
Since Acronis Disk Director can work properly in Windows7 Pro 64-bit, there should be some mechanism to handle more than 4GB RAM. I just wonder this mechanism can be created in winpe to solve this problem?
